Number of poultry birds in Cape Verde
Cape Verde: Number of poultry birds was 681,000 animals in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Number of poultry birds in Cape Verde, 1961–2024
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(2025)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in animals.
Analysis
The most recent figure for number of poultry birds in Cape Verde is 681,000 animals, measured in 2024.
The figure is up 1.2% on the previous year and down 31.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of poultry birds in Cape Verde peaked at 1.12 million animals in 2013 and was at its lowest, 41,000 animals, in 1961.
Cape Verde ranks 169th of 198 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 46,000 animals | 41,000 animals | 52,000 animals | 9 |
| 1970s | 88,700 animals | 53,000 animals | 200,000 animals | 10 |
| 1980s | 393,300 animals | 250,000 animals | 510,000 animals | 10 |
| 1990s | 467,400 animals | 421,000 animals | 510,000 animals | 10 |
| 2000s | 366,800 animals | 174,000 animals | 588,000 animals | 10 |
| 2010s | 881,700 animals | 500,000 animals | 1.12 million animals | 10 |
| 2020s | 671,800 animals | 650,000 animals | 690,000 animals | 5 |
